Over 38,600 visit Kim Lien relic site in Nghe An
Over 38,600 visitors arrived at Kim Lien relic site in Nam Dan district, the central province of Nghe An from May 17-19, on the occasion of the 128th birth anniversary of President Ho Chi Minh (May 19). 
Kim Lien relic site greets over 20,000 tourists during National Day holiday
During the three-day holiday on the occasion of National Day (September 2nd), more than 20,000 tourists flocked to the homeland of President Ho Chi Minh, according to Nghe An news.

Performance of Vi and Giam folk songs of Nghe Tinh in Kim Lien Relic Site
(TITC) - Since September 2015, the art program themed “Performance of Vi and Giam folk songs of Nghe Tinh - Intangible Cultural Heritage of Humanity” will be organized free for visitors in Kim Lien Relic Site (Kim Lien Commune, Nam Dan District, Nghe An Province).
Over 136,000 travelers visit Uncle Ho’s hometown
During six day holiday, Kim Lien relic site in the central province of Nam Dan's Nghe An where is President Ho Chi Minh's hometown and considered as an attractive destination, received more than 136, 000 domestic visitors and 11 international delegates from Laos, Russia, Korea, America, Rumani, reported Director of Kim Lien relic area Nguyen Ba Hoe on May 4.
